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Luton to Aveiro is to fly and train which costs €80 - €260 and takes 5h 45m.
The fastest way to get from Luton to Aveiro is to fly and towncar which takes 3h 51m and costs €170 - €300.
The distance between Luton and Aveiro is 1423 km.
The best way to get from Luton to Aveiro without a car is to train and bus via Antony which takes 26h 59m and costs €290 - €600.
It takes approximately 3h 51m to get from Luton to Aveiro, including transfers.

There is no direct connection from Luton to Aveiro. However, you can fly to Francisco De Sá Carneiro Airport (OPO), walk to Porto - Aeroporto Francisco Sá Carneiro, then take the towncar to Aveiro. Alternatively, you can take a train from Luton to Terminal Rodoviário de Aveiro via London St Pancras Intl, Paris Nord, Massy - Palaiseau, Paris - Massy-Palaiseau, and Centro Coordenador de Transportes da Guarda in around 26h 59m.
